A timber pillar
A timber pillar is the basic wooden support in the Pillars and Beams category. It costs two Wood, builds in 1s, and has 750 max health. Pillars hold up floors and roofs and let you build upward, so a timber pillar is usually one of the first vertical supports you place when adding a second storey to a starter house.

For a longer support, the large variant covers the full height of a tall storey. The Large Pillar (Timber), Large Pillar (Sticks), and Large Pillar (Weathered) are the tall counterparts. Other finishes in the standard size include:

Progression Notes
Pillar (Timber) is placed during base building with the construction hammer once its plan is learned. As a cheap vertical support among the building pieces, it is ideal for early multi-storey builds before you switch to stone or plaster pillars.
